Multiple Testing Procedures: R Multtest Package And Applications To Genomics, Katherine S. Pollard, Sandrine Dudoit, Mark J. Van Der Laan

U.C. Berkeley Division of Biostatistics Working Paper Series

The Bioconductor R package multtest implements widely applicable resampling-based single-step and stepwise multiple testing procedures (MTP) for controlling a broad class of Type I error rates, in testing problems involving general data generating distributions (with arbitrary dependence structures among variables), null hypotheses, and test statistics. The current version of multtest provides MTPs for tests concerning means, differences in means, and regression parameters in linear and Cox proportional hazards models. Procedures are provided to control Type I error rates defined as tail probabilities for arbitrary functions of the numbers of false positives and rejected hypotheses. Further Results On Strongbox Secured Secret Sharing Schemes, G. Gamble, B. M. Maenhaut, Jennifer Seberry, A. Penfold Street

Faculty of Informatics - Papers (Archive)

We extend our earlier work on ways in which defining sets of combinatorial designs can be used to create secret sharing schemes. We give an algorithm for classifying defining sets of designs according to their security properties and summarise the results of this algorithm for many small designs. Finally, we discuss briefly how defining sets can be applied to variations of the basic secret sharing scheme.

Flicker Transfer In Radial Power Systems, Sankika Tennakoon, Lakshal Perera, D A. Robinson, Sarath Perera

Faculty of Informatics - Papers (Archive)

Loads which exhibit continuous and rapid variations in their current can cause voltage fluctuations that are often referred to as flicker. One good example for such loads is arc furnaces which are usually fed by dedicated feeders from the high voltage busbars in transmission systems. The flicker generated from such loads will propagate to the upstream HV point of common coupling (PCC), and from there to the downstream through the transmission and sub transmission systems. Assessing The Future Of Electrical Power Engineering: A Report On Electrical Power Engineering Manpower Requirements In Australia, Victor J. Gosbell, D A. Robinson

Faculty of Informatics - Papers (Archive)

In 2001 the Electric Energy Society of Australia (EESA) developed concerns based on anecdotal evidence that there was a looming shortage of electrical power engineers in Australia. Information from the electrical power industry and academic communities was obtained through two separate survey questionnaires, a discussion workshop, and a number of submissions. This information was collated and compiled into 'Assessing the Future of Electrical Power Engineering: a Report on Electrical Power Engineering Manpower Requirements in Australia'.

Data Management For Large Scale Power Quality Surveys, Murray-Luke Peard, Sean T. Elphick, Victor W. Smith, Victor J. Gosbell, D A. Robinson

Faculty of Informatics - Papers (Archive)

For large scale power quality surveys, the management of the large amount of data generated is a major issue. This paper presents solutions to three main areas of data management, viz. a data interchange format, database design and data processing. Consideration of these issues has come about as a result of the Long Term National Power Quality Survey currently being conducted by the University of Wollongong, and reference is made to that specific application for illustrative purposes.

Experimental Determination Of The Evolution Of The Bjorken Integral At Low Q², A. Deur, P. Bosted, V. Burkert, G. Cates, J.P. Chen, Seonho Choi, D. Crabb, C.W. De Jager, R. De Vita, G.E. Dodge, R. Fatemi, T.A. Forest, F. Garibaldi, R. Gilman, E. W. Hughes, X. Jiang, W. Korsch, S. E. Kuhn, W. Melnitchouk, Z.-E. Meziani, R. Minehart, A.V. Skabelin, K. Slifer, M. Taiuti, J. Yun

Physics Faculty Publications

We extract the Bjorken integral 𝚪1p-n in the range 0.17 < Q2 <1.10 GeV2 from inclusive scattering of polarized electrons by polarized protons, deuterons, and 3He, for the region in which the integral is dominated by nucleon resonances. These data bridge the domains of the hadronic and partonic descriptions of the nucleon. In combination with earlier measurements at higher Q2, we extract the nonsinglet twist-4 matrix element f2.
